Interview happened in two days. I first gave a 1 hour seminar with Q&A. Then I had multiple one on one meetings to talk to peers and directors. They asked multiple questions during the seminar as well as one on ones.

Tiered interview process, first with HR, then hiring manager. I didn't make it past the HM interview. They were looking for someone with very specific skill set. Overall good experience and I was happy they weeded me out early, rather than bring me through longer process if I wasn't going to be a good fit.

Received an interview from hiring committee via email and did research talk for the first interview. General interviews with recruiter and hiring manager were skipped. It was 30 min interview, 15-20 min research talk with QnA.
